一个念头
最近在用AI写代码的时候,我突然冒出一个想法:既然AI这么强大了,为什么我们还要重复"喂"它同样的话?
比如我想做一个待办事项应用,我得跟AI说:"帮我用React写一个待办事项应用,要有增删改查功能,界面用Tailwind CSS美化一下......"然后它生成了代码,我跑起来,发现问题,再继续对话,反复调整。
这个过程虽然比手写快很多,但本质上,每次都是从零开始的"对话式开发" 。
那有没有一种可能------把这些已经被验证有效的、能够完整生成某个项目的提示词,都收集起来、分类整理好,让每个人拿来就能用?
我想做的事
我想搭建一个平台,一个专门为AI编程而生的"提示词超市"。
这个平台上,会有各种各样的项目提示词模板:
- 一个完整的前端项目:电商前台、管理后台、个人博客、在线简历生成器......
- 一个完整的后端服务:用户认证系统、API网关、数据看板、定时任务调度......
- 一个完整的全栈应用:待办事项、聊天室、笔记应用、短链接服务......
- 一个实用的工具脚本:数据爬虫、文件批处理、自动化测试、PDF生成器......
用户不需要懂技术细节,甚至不需要知道什么是前端什么是后端。他只需要来到这个平台,找到自己想要的那个项目,复制提示词,粘贴到AI里(Cursor、Claude、ChatGPT、Windsurf......),然后等待项目生成。
一句话概括:给AI提示词,拿回一个能跑起来的项目。
为什么想做这个
我想到这个点子,主要有三个原因:
第一,AI编程的门槛还是太高了
现在虽然AI能写代码,但"怎么问"其实是一门学问。很多人不知道怎么写好的提示词,不知道如何描述需求,不知道如何迭代修改。结果就是:AI很强,但普通人用不起来。
如果把提示词提前写好、打磨好,用户只需要"复制-粘贴-运行",这个门槛就几乎降为零了。
第二,重复劳动太浪费了
我自己在写项目的时候,发现很多提示词其实是通用的。做一个登录页面,做一个博客系统,做一个管理后台------这些需求几乎每个开发者都会遇到,但每个人都在重复造轮子(重复写提示词)。
既然代码有开源社区,为什么提示词不能有一个共享平台?
第三,从"教AI"到"用AI"的转变
现在的AI编程,本质上是"人教AI":人告诉AI要做什么,AI执行。但这个模式里,人是那个"懂技术的人"。
我希望的是:哪怕你不懂技术,只要你想做一个东西,就能在这个平台上找到对应的提示词,然后让AI帮你实现。
一些困惑和思考
当然,这个想法还有很多需要想清楚的地方:
版权问题怎么办? 提示词本身算不算创作?如果用户用平台的提示词生成了代码,代码的归属是谁?这些可能需要好好界定。
平台的价值在哪里? AI本身也在变得越来越聪明,未来可能不需要这么精细的提示词了,一个简单的需求就能生成复杂项目。那时候,这个平台还有意义吗?
我的想法是:AI越强大,人类的需求就越复杂、越具体。平台的价值不在于"教AI怎么做事",而在于帮用户想清楚"自己要做什么" 。很多时候,用户不是不会用AI,而是不知道自己要做什么、怎么做。平台提供的,其实是"思路"和"模板"。
这个平台是给谁用的? 是给程序员,还是给不懂技术的普通人?
我觉得两者都重要。程序员可以用它快速搭建项目骨架,节省时间;普通人可以用它实现自己的小想法,不需要学编程。
写在最后
我知道这个想法还很不成熟,还有很多细节需要推敲。但我隐隐觉得,这可能是未来的一种方向------AI编程的"应用商店" 。
代码不再是最终产品,提示词才是。好的提示词,就像当年的"一键安装包",让技术从少数人的专利,变成大众的工具。
我不知道这个平台最终能不能做成,也不知道它会变成什么样子。但我很想试一试。
如果你对这个想法感兴趣,或者有什么建议,欢迎一起聊聊。也许,我们可以一起做点什么。
这是我想做的一件事。记录在这里,算是立一个flag吧。